What is BibLivre?
BibLivre is an open source integrated library system designed for libraries of all sizes. It includes modules for the following core functions:
- Cataloging - Create, manage and organize bibliographic records for materials in the library's collection.
- Circulation - Check materials in and out to patrons, manage loans and holds.
- OPAC - Provide an online public access catalog for patrons to search and access library holdings information.
- Patron management - Create and manage patron database, memberships and account information.
- Acquisitions and serials - Track orders and subscriptions.
- Reports - Generate statistical reports on library collections, usage, transactions etc.
Key features include Z39.50 integration for importing records from other databases, customizable search, flexible management of various material types, support for RFID, integration with external authentication sources and APIs for interoperability. The system is designed to be easily customized and extended for local needs.
As an open source system, BibLivre provides libraries an option to have more control and flexibility over their ILS, compared to proprietary systems. The modular architecture and open APIs allow libraries to modify the system to meet their specific needs.
